跳转到主要内容

Odoo图形BI视图构建器

项目描述

Beta License: AGPL-3 OCA/reporting-engine Translate me on Weblate Try me on Runbot

BI视图编辑器是集成在Odoo中的工具,允许用户定义和执行自己的报告,而无需编码。

目的

  • BI视图编辑器用于创建标准Odoo中未包含的报告,结合现有数据源的数据。

  • 它被设计成供对Odoo的技术架构知之甚少或一无所知的使用者使用。用户可以直观地链接业务对象并选择要可视化的字段。

  • BI视图编辑器为用户提供不同类型的表示方式,包括树形、图形、交叉表视图。

目录

安装

在Odoo配置文件中,将bi_view_editor添加到server_wide_modules列表中

[options]
(...)
server_wide_modules = web,bi_view_editor
(...)

或者,在命令行启动Odoo时指定--load=bi_view_editor

可选地,可以启用ER图视图。为此,您需要安装开源图形可视化软件Graphviz

``sudo apt-get install graphviz``

使用方法

为了图形化设计您的分析数据集

  • 从仪表板菜单,选择“自定义BI视图”

  • 在“查询构建器”标签中浏览业务对象

  • 选择感兴趣的字段(拖放)

  • 对于每个选定的字段,在“选项”列上右键单击并选择它是行、列还是度量;如果您想从列表视图中删除字段,请取消选中“选项”列中的“列表”复选框

  • 保存并点击“生成BI视图”

  • 点击“打开BI视图”查看结果

通过专用菜单访问创建的BI视图

  • 如果已安装模块仪表板(板),则标准“添加到我的仪表板”功能将可用

  • 点击“创建菜单”以直接创建与您的新BI视图相关联的新菜单项(此功能在开发者模式中可用);当BI视图重置回草稿时,此菜单将被删除,您需要重新创建菜单条目。

在“详细信息”标签下还可用更高级的UI。它为高级用户提供额外功能,例如使用LEFT JOIN代替默认的INNER JOIN。

还可以通过在“SQL”标签中添加一个< cite>Over Condition来改进新视图的ID生成。有关详细信息,请参阅https://postgresql.ac.cn/docs/current/sql-expressions.html#SYNTAX-WINDOW-FUNCTIONS。例如,ORDER BY子句有助于防止在过滤生成的视图时出现不可靠的行为。

已知问题/路线图

  • 不支持非存储字段和多对多字段。

  • 提供教程(例如,使用示例的工作示例)。

  • 尝试找到更好的方法来扩展< em>_auto_init()而不覆盖。

  • 可能避免猴子补丁。

  • 用户无法访问的数据(例如,在多公司情况下)可以通过创建视图进行查看。如果创建视图时可供选择的模型限于具有交集的组,将很棒。

错误跟踪器

错误在GitHub Issues上跟踪。如果遇到问题,请检查是否已报告您的问题。如果您首先发现,请通过提供详细且受欢迎的反馈来帮助我们解决它。

请不要直接联系贡献者以获取支持或技术问题的帮助。

致谢

作者

  • Onestein

贡献者

其他致谢

资助者

此模块为Odoo 11.0的开发提供了财务支持

维护者

此模块由OCA维护。

Odoo Community Association

OCA,或Odoo社区协会,是一个非营利组织,其使命是支持Odoo功能的协作开发并推广其广泛应用。

此模块是GitHub上的OCA/reporting-engine项目的一部分。

欢迎您贡献。有关如何贡献的更多信息,请访问https://odoo-community.org/page/Contribute

项目详情


下载文件

下载适用于您的平台的文件。如果您不确定选择哪个,请了解更多关于安装包的信息。

源代码分发

此版本没有可用的源代码分发文件。请参阅生成分发存档的教程

构建分发

odoo12_addon_bi_view_editor-12.0.1.1.1-py3-none-any.whl (299.4 kB 查看哈希值)

上传时间 Python 3

由以下机构支持